Master Gardener Activity Log

Information should be recorded each year from January 1st – December 31st (estimate to end of year). Use information you have accumulated all year and submit this form as your final summary. To remain an active master gardener you must submit an annual report each year by the required county deadline.

What All Volunteers Need to Know About Liability

All assignments and activities must be on record at the county extension office.  Unless the DeKalb County Cooperative Extension assigns you an activity/event, you are not working under the auspices or approval of DeKalb County or the University of Georgia.
